1. Understanding the Mile and Meter
The question “How many meters is a mile” is a common one, bridging the gap between the imperial and metric systems. A mile is a unit of length primarily used in the United States and the United Kingdom, while the meter is a fundamental unit of length in the metric system, used globally for scientific and standard measurements.
1.1 The Official Conversion: Mile to Meters
The precise conversion factor reveals that 1 mile equals 1,609.344 meters. This number is essential for accurate conversions in various fields, including sports, engineering, and everyday life.

1.3 Historical Context of Miles and Meters
The mile has ancient Roman origins, evolving over centuries into the statute mile we use today. In contrast, the meter was created during the French Revolution as part of an effort to establish a universal measurement system based on scientific principles.
- Mile: Derived from the Roman “mille passus,” meaning a thousand paces, with each pace being about five feet.
- Meter: Originally defined as one ten-millionth of the distance from the equator to the North Pole along a meridian.
2. Step-by-Step Guide to Converting Miles to Meters
Converting miles to meters is straightforward once you understand the basic formula. Here’s a step-by-step guide:
2.1 The Conversion Formula
To convert miles to meters, use the following formula:
Meters = Miles × 1,609.344
2.2 Example Conversion
Let’s convert 5 miles to meters:
Meters = 5 × 1,609.344 = 8,046.72 meters
So, 5 miles is equal to 8,046.72 meters.
2.3 Simplified Conversion for Quick Estimates
For quick estimations, you can round the conversion factor to 1,600:
Meters ≈ Miles × 1,600
Using this simplified formula, 5 miles would be approximately 8,000 meters.

5. Understanding Kilometers in Relation to Miles and Meters
Kilometers (km) provide another layer of understanding distances, being a larger unit in the metric system.
5.1 Converting Kilometers to Meters
1 kilometer = 1,000 meters
This conversion is straightforward and commonly used. For example, a 5 km run is 5,000 meters.
5.2 Converting Kilometers to Miles
1 kilometer ≈ 0.621371 miles
To convert kilometers to miles, multiply the number of kilometers by 0.621371. For example:
5 km = 5 × 0.621371 = 3.106855 miles

7. The Metric System: A Global Standard
The metric system is the standard system of measurement in most countries, known for its simplicity and consistency.
7.1 Basic Units of the Metric System
- Length: Meter (m)
- Mass: Kilogram (kg)
- Time: Second (s)
- Temperature: Kelvin (K)
- Electric Current: Ampere (A)
- Amount of Substance: Mole (mol)
- Luminous Intensity: Candela (cd)
7.2 Advantages of the Metric System
- Decimal-Based: Easy to use and convert between units.
- Universally Accepted: Used in almost all countries, facilitating international communication.
- Scientific Standard: Used in scientific research and measurements worldwide.
7.3 Common Metric Prefixes
- Kilo (k): 1,000 (e.g., 1 kilometer = 1,000 meters)
- Hecto (h): 100 (e.g., 1 hectometer = 100 meters)
- Deca (da): 10 (e.g., 1 decameter = 10 meters)
- Deci (d): 0.1 (e.g., 1 decimeter = 0.1 meters)
- Centi (c): 0.01 (e.g., 1 centimeter = 0.01 meters)
- Milli (m): 0.001 (e.g., 1 millimeter = 0.001 meters)
7.4 Adoption of the Metric System
Most countries have officially adopted the metric system, with the United States being a notable exception. The U.S. continues to use the imperial system for many everyday measurements.
7.5 The International System of Units (SI)
The SI system is the modern form of the metric system and is the world’s most widely used system of measurement. It provides a standardized framework for scientific and technological measurements.
